Event description
Employee killed in fall through skylight
Investigation abstract
Employee #1 and coworkers were on a flat roof, assisting in the helicopter remov al of roof fans. As they backed away from a fan that was being lifted, Employee #1 tripped and fell sideways through a 50 in. by 90 in. plastic-covered skylight . He fell 30 ft to a concrete floor, sustaining fatal head injuries. Employee #1 died at the site.
